Varkala Bachelor Party Itinerary

Saturday, September 30, 2023: Arrival and Beach Relaxation

Start your bachelor party trip in Varkala by arriving at the Trivandrum International Airport. From there, take a taxi or hire a private car to Varkala, which is approximately a one-hour drive away. Check-in at your beachfront hotel or resort and enjoy the stunning views of the Arabian Sea. Spend the morning relaxing on the golden sandy beaches and taking a dip in the crystal-clear waters. In the afternoon, explore the vibrant Varkala Beach Market, known for its handicrafts, beachwear, and local snacks. As the evening sets in, head to one of the beachside restaurants or shacks for a delicious seafood dinner and enjoy the lively atmosphere.

  • Varkala Beach: Free, Time spent: Half-day
  • Varkala Beach Market: Free, Time spent: 2-3 hours
  • Beachside Restaurant: Estimated cost: ₹1500-₹2500 per person, Time spent: Evening
Sunday, October 1, 2023: Adventure and Water Sports

Start your morning with a thrilling adventure at the Kappil Lake and Backwaters. Take a boat ride or go kayaking through the serene backwaters, surrounded by lush greenery. Afterward, head to the Papanasam Beach, famous for its natural mineral springs and believed to have therapeutic properties. Take a dip in the sacred waters and relax on the beach. In the afternoon, indulge in water sports activities such as surfing, parasailing, or jet skiing at the nearby beaches. In the evening, explore the cliff area of Varkala, which is lined with shops, cafes, and bars, perfect for a bachelor party celebration.

  • Kappil Lake and Backwaters: Estimated cost: ₹1000-₹1500 per person, Time spent: Half-day
  • Papanasam Beach: Free, Time spent: 2-3 hours
  • Water Sports Activities: Estimated cost: ₹1000-₹3000 per person, Time spent: Afternoon
  • Varkala Cliff: Free, Time spent: Evening
Monday, October 2, 2023: Ayurvedic Spa and Temple Visit

Embark on a morning wellness journey with an Ayurvedic spa experience. Varkala is known for its traditional Ayurvedic treatments and therapies. Indulge in a rejuvenating massage or a relaxing yoga session. Afterward, visit the Janardanaswamy Temple, a significant Hindu pilgrimage site. Explore the temple's beautiful architecture and witness the rituals performed by the devotees. In the afternoon, take a leisurely stroll along the scenic Varkala Cliff and enjoy the panoramic views of the Arabian Sea. As the evening approaches, gather at a beachside bonfire and celebrate your bachelor party with music, drinks, and local delicacies.

  • Ayurvedic Spa: Estimated cost: ₹2000-₹5000 per person, Time spent: Morning
  • Janardanaswamy Temple: Free, Time spent: 1-2 hours
  • Varkala Cliff: Free, Time spent: Afternoon
  • Beachside Bonfire: Estimated cost: ₹3000-₹5000, Time spent: Evening
Tuesday, October 3, 2023: Backwater Cruise and Farewell

On your last day in Varkala, embark on a backwater cruise along the tranquil stretches of the Thiruvallam backwaters. Enjoy the scenic beauty, spot exotic bird species, and immerse yourself in the peaceful surroundings. After the cruise, visit the Anjengo Fort, a historical landmark with Portuguese and Dutch influences. Explore the fort's ruins, cannons, and enjoy the panoramic views of the coastline. In the afternoon, savor a traditional Kerala lunch at a local restaurant before heading back to Trivandrum International Airport for your departure.

  • Backwater Cruise: Estimated cost: ₹2000-₹3000 per person, Time spent: Morning
  • Anjengo Fort: Free, Time spent: 1-2 hours
  • Kerala Lunch: Estimated cost: ₹500-₹1000 per person, Time spent: Afternoon

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

While exploring Varkala, don't miss the opportunity to visit the Edava Beach, a lesser-known beach that offers a tranquil and secluded atmosphere. It's an ideal spot for a private beach party with your bachelor party group. Another hidden gem is the Varkala Tunnel, a secret passageway through the cliff, offering breathtaking views of the Varkala coastline. Locals love to visit the Sivagiri Mutt, a spiritual and cultural center founded by the great philosopher Sree Narayana Guru. It's a serene place to learn about Kerala's spirituality and philosophy. For a unique experience, consider attending a Kathakali performance, a traditional dance-drama form of Kerala, showcasing elaborate costumes and expressive movements.
